This collection of readings has been put together by Manghani (critical and cultural theory, York St. John U., UK), Piper (image studies and visual culture, U. of Nottingham, UK), and Simons (communications, Indiana U., US), in part, as a response to W.J.T. Mitchell's complaint that "there is, at present, no real `field' in the humanities . no `iconology' that studies the problem of perceptual, conceptual, verbal and graphic images in a unified way." In pursuit of such an interdisciplinary field of image studies, they gather 81 essays and excerpts of longer works in order to indicate the types of concerns, methods of inquiry, subjects of study, and disciplinary connections that would constitute the field. Historical and philosophical precedents are presented in selections from the Bible, Plato, Aristotle, Descartes, Hobbes, Locke, Kant, Marx, Nietzsche, Freud, and others. Theories of images are examined in sections dealing with ideology critique, art history, semiotics, phenomenology, and psychoanalysis. Finally, image culture is explored in sections on images and words, image as thought, image fabrication, visual culture, vision and visuality, and image studies. Among the notable authors represented in these last two sections are Régis Debray, Susan Sontag, Marshall Mcluhan, Sergei Eisenstein, Paul Klee, Marcel Proust, Ludwig Wittgenstein, Walter Benjamin, Michel Foucault, Martin Heidegger, Roland Barthes, Jacques Lacan, Jean Baudrillard, Charles Sanders Peirce, and Theodor Adorno.
